5 Series MSO Low Profile

In applications that demand extreme channel density, the 5 Series MSO Low Profile oscilloscope sets a new standard for performance. With 12-bit analog-to-digital converters, this high speed digitizer offers 8 input channels (plus AUX Trig) in a compact package, only 3.5 inches high (2U).

  • 8 analog/spectral channels or 64 digital
  • 6.25 GS/s sample rate
  • 500 MHz – 1 GHz bandwidth
  • Closed Embedded OS only
  • Supports probes
  • 50 Ohm and 1 MOhm inputs

Key performance specifications

Input channels

  • 8 FlexChannel® inputs
  • Each FlexChannel provides:
    • One analog signal that can be displayed as a waveform view, a spectral view, or both simultaneously
    • Eight digital logic inputs with TLP058 logic probe

Bandwidth (all analog channels)

  • 1 GHz, 500 MHz (upgradable)

Sample rate (all analog / digital channels)

  • Real-time: 6.25 GS/s
  • Interpolated: 500 GS/s

Record length (all analog / digital channels)

  • 125 Mpoints (std.)
  • 250, 500 Mpoints (optional)

Waveform capture rate

  • >500,000 waveforms/s

Vertical resolution

  • 12-bit ADC
  • Up to 16-bits in High Res mode
  • 7.6 ENOB at 1 GHz

Standard trigger types

  • Edge, Pulse Width, Runt, Timeout, Window, Logic, Setup & Hold, Rise/Fall Time, Parallel Bus, Sequence, Visual Trigger, Video (optional), RF vs. Time (optional)
  • Auxiliary Trigger ≤5 VRMS, 50Ω, 200 MHz (Edge Trigger only)

Standard analysis

  • Measurements: 36
  • Spectrum View: Frequency-domain analysis with independent controls for frequency and time domains RF vs. time traces (magnitude, frequency, phase)
  • FastFrame™: Segmented memory acquisition mode with maximum trigger rate >5,000,000 waveforms per second
  • Plots: Time Trend, Histogram, Spectrum and Phase Noise
  • Math: Basic waveform arithmetic, FFT, and advanced equation editor
  • Search: Search on any trigger criteria
  • Jitter: TIE and Phase Noise

Optional analysis (optional and upgradable)

  • Advanced Jitter and Eye Diagram Analysis
  • User-defined filtering
  • Advanced Spectrum View
  • RF vs. Time traces, triggers, Spectrograms, and IQ capture
  • Digital Power Management
  • Mask/Limit Testing
  • Inverters, Motors, and Drives
  • Advanced Power Measurements and Analysis

Optional protocol trigger, decode, and analysis (optional and upgradable)

I2C, SPI, eSPI, I3C, RS-232/422/485/UART, SPMI, SMBus, CAN, CAN FD, CAN XL, LIN, FlexRay, SENT, PSI5, CXPI, Automotive Ethernet,MIPI C-PHY,MIPI D-PHY, USB 2.0, eUSB2.0, Ethernet, EtherCAT, Audio, MIL-STD-1553, ARINC 429, Spacewire, 8B/10B,NRZ, Manchester, SVID, SDLC, 1-Wire, MDIO, and NFC

Arbitrary/Function Generator (optional and upgradable)

  • MHz waveform generation
  • Waveform Types: Arbitrary, Sine, Square, Pulse, Ramp, Triangle, DC Level, Gaussian, Lorentz, Exponential Rise/Fall, Sin(x)/x, Random Noise, Haversine, Cardiac

Digital voltmeter (free with product registration)

  • 4-digit AC RMS, DC, and DC+AC RMS voltage measurements

Trigger frequency counter (free with product registration)

  • 8-digit

Video display output

  • High Definition (1,920 x 1,080) resolution video output

Connectivity

  • USB Host (6 ports), USB 3.0 Device (1 port), LAN (10/100/1000 Base-T Ethernet), DisplayPort, DVI-D, VGA

e*Scope®

  • Remotely view and control the oscilloscope over a network connection through a standard web browser

Operating system

  • Closed Embedded OS

Warranty

  • 3 years standard
